To the savage, all is spirit. The meanest objects are charged with influence, the commonest actions fraught with spiritual possibilities, the operations of nature one and all are brought about by spiritual powers--but powers multifarious and conflicting. “Nature can have little unity for savages. It is a Walpurgis-nacht procession, a checkered play of light and shadow, a medley of impish and elfish, friendly and inimical powers.”[44]

But with ordered civilization and dispassionate observation a network of material cause and effect invaded this spiritual domain. The mysterious influences, for example, believed to be inherent in springs and running rivers became personified, and, anthropomorphized as nymphs or gods, were removed into a seclusion more remote from practical and everyday life than their unpersonified predecessors. Later, they retreated still farther from actuality into a half-believed mythology, and then passed away into the powerlessness of avowed fairy-story or literary symbolism, while the rivers, perceived as the resultant of natural forces, were more and more harnessed to man’s use. So with the wind and the rain, the growth of crops, the storms of the sea. So, in due time, with the thunder and the lightning, with earthquakes, eruptions, comets, eclipses, pestilences.

This process of liberating matter from arbitrary and mysterious power, of perceiving it as orderly and endowed with regularity of natural law, of bringing it more and more beneath human control, was, on the other hand, accompanied by what may be called a combined condensation and sublimation of the spiritual forces accepted by human faith. They are built up from spirit to spirits, spirits to gods, gods to God. But now it seems as if this condensation had reached its limit, and the sublimation could only go farther by resolving the one God into an empty name or the vaguest unreality.

We look back and see the Gods of early man, and are complacently prepared to believe that they were based in error, products of mental immaturity, to be relegated to limbo without regret. But what about the present? Why should we shrink from applying the same process to the God of to-day?

Is it then to be so with every God? Is God only a personified symbol of our residuum of ignorance? Is to hold the idea of God in any form to be, as Salomon Reinach believes, in an infantile stage of human development, and must we with him define religion as “a sum of beliefs impeding the free use of human faculty”?

I think not; and I shall endeavour to justify my belief to you, and to show that, albeit much alteration and a thorough revision of ideas is needed, the term _God_ has an important scientific connotation, and further that the present stagnation of religion can be remedied if, as has happened again and again in biological evolution, the old forms become extinct or subordinate, and a new dominant type is developed along quite fresh lines.

In any case the man of science must obviously, if he face the problem at all, take up a scientific attitude of mind towards it. He cannot say that there is no such thing as religion; or try to whittle it away by explaining that it is something else--a complicated fear, or a sublimated sex-instinct, or a combination of credulity and duplicity. A thing, if it is a thing at all, is never merely something else. Nor can he submit to the pretensions of those who assert that it is too sacred to be touched, or that its certainties are greater than those of science. No--he must treat it for what it is--a fact, and a very important fact at that, in human history: and he must see whether the application of scientific method to its study--in other words, its illumination by the faculty of pure intellect--will help not only our comprehension of religion in the past, but its actual development in the future.

He can study it in various ways. He can use the method of observation and comparison, collecting and collating facts until he is able to give a connected account of the manifestations of religion and of their past history; he can study it physiologically, so to speak, to see what part it plays in the body politic, and how that part may alter with circumstances; or he may seek to investigate its essence, to discover not only how it appears and what it does, but what it _is_.

Further, he must have some general principles to lean on in his search, principles both positive and negative. He must be content to leave certain possibilities out of account because as yet he cannot see how they can be connected with his organized scheme of things; in other words, he has to be content to build slowly and imperfectly in order that he may be sure of building soundly. This is the principle which we may call positive agnosticism.

This very fact has been in the past one of the great obstacles in the way of successful treatment of religion by science. One of the attributes of man is his desire for a complete explanation, or at least a complete view, of his universe, and this has been at the bottom of much doctrine and many creeds. But before Kepler and Newton, no truly scientific account could be given of celestial phenomena; before Darwin, none of Natural History; before the recent revival in psychology, none of the mind and its workings. In the second half of the nineteenth century, for instance, science could give an adequate account of most inorganic phenomena, and, in broad outline, of evolutionary geology and biology; but mind was still refractory. Accordingly, the philosophy of science was mainly materialist. But the common man felt that mind was not the empty epiphenomenon that orthodox science would have it; and he desired a scheme of things in which mind should be more adequately explained than it could be by science at its then stage of development. _Hinc illae lacrimae._

To-day it is at least possible to link up, not only physics and chemistry and geology and evolutionary biology, but also anthropology and psychology, into a whole which, though far from complete, is at least organized and coherent with itself. If the seventeenth century cleared the ground for that dwelling-place of human mind which we call the scientific view of things, if the eighteenth century laid the foundations and the nineteenth built the walls, the twentieth is already fitting up some of the rooms for actual habitation.

There are certain other domains of reality which have not yet been properly investigated by science. Telepathy, for instance, and the whole mass of phenomena included broadly under the term spiritualism, are in about the some position with regard to organized scientific thought to-day as was astronomy before astrology’s collapse, as was the study of electricity in the eighteenth century, or that of hypnotism in the middle of the nineteenth. What is more, the average man demands that phenomena of this order shall be included in his scheme of things. Science cannot yet do this for him; and accordingly the dwelling-place that we are building must still be incomplete; it is for those who come after to build the upper stories.

This cannot be helped. What we build, we must build firmly; on what is yet to be built, science cannot pronounce, except to say that she knows that it will be congruous with what has gone before.

What general principles, then, do we assume? We assume that the universe is composed throughout of the same matter, whose essential unity, in spite of the diversity of its so-called elements, the recent researches of physicists are revealing to us; we assume that matter behaves in the same way wherever it is found, showing the same mode of sequence of change, of cause and effect. We assume, on fairly good although indirect evidence, that there has been an evolution of the forms assumed by matter; that, in this solar system of ours, for instance, matter was once all in electronic form, that it then attained to the atomic and the molecular; that later, colloidal organic matter of a special type made its appearance, and later still, living matter arose. That the forms of life, simple at first, attained progressively to greater complexity; that mind, negligible in the lower forms, became of greater and greater importance, until it reached its present level in man.[45]

Unity, uniformity, and development are the three great principles that emerge. We know of no instance where the properties of matter change, though many where a new state of matter develops. The full properties of a molecular compound such as water, for instance, cannot be deduced at present from what we know about the properties of its constituent atoms of hydrogen and oxygen. The properties of the human mind cannot be deduced from our present knowledge of the minds of animals. New combinations and properties thus arise in time. Bergson miscalls such evolution “creative.” We had better, with Lloyd Morgan, call it “emergent.”

With mind, we find a gradual evolution from a state in which it is impossible to distinguish mental response from physiological reaction, up to the intensity and complexity of our own emotions and intellect. Since all material developments in evolution can be traced back step by step and shown to be specializations of one or more of the primitive properties of living matter, it is not only an economy of hypothesis, but also, in the absence of any evidence to the contrary, the proper conclusion, that mental properties also are to be traced back to the simplest and most original forms of life. What exact significance is to be attached to the term “mental properties” in such organisms, it is hard to say; we mean, however, that something of the same general nature as mind in ourselves is inherent in all life, something standing in the same relation to living matter in general as do our minds to the particular living matter of our brains.

But there can be no reasonable doubt that living matter, in due process of time, originated from non-living; and if that be so, we must push our conclusion farther, and believe that not only living matter, but all matter, is associated with something of the same general description as mind in higher animals. We come, that is, to a monistic conclusion, in that we believe that there is only one fundamental substance, and that this possesses not only material properties, but also properties for which the word _mental_ is the nearest approach. We want a new word to denote this _X_, this world-stuff; _matter_ will not do, for that is a word which the physicists and chemists have moulded to suit themselves, and since they have not yet learned to detect or measure mental phenomena, they restrict the word “material” to mean “non-mental,” and “matter” to mean that which has such “material” properties.

You will remember William of Occam’s razor; “Entia non multiplicanda praeter necessitatem”; when we are monists in the sense I have just outlined, we are using that weapon to shave away a very unrestrained growth of hair which has long obscured the features of reality.

Holding to these principles, we must, until evidence to the contrary is produced, reject any explanation which proceeds by cataclysms, or by miracles; a miracle becomes (when not an illusion) simply an event which is on the one hand uncommon, and for which, on the other, there has been found no explanation. Revelation too goes by the board--save a revelation which is simply a name for the progressive increase of knowledge and insight.

Last, but not least, we do not pretend to know the Absolute. We know phenomena, and our systems, in so far as scientific, are interpretations of phenomena.

Religion has been defined in a hundred different ways. It has been defined intellectually--as a creed; as myth; as a view of the universe; it has been defined emotionally as consisting in awe; in fear; in love; in mystical exaltation or communion. It has been defined from the standpoint of action--as worship; as ritual; as sacrifice; as morality. Matthew Arnold called it “morality tinged with emotion”; Salomon Reinach “a sum of scruples impeding the free use of human faculties.” Jevons makes the experiencing of God the central feature; and so on and so forth. Is it possible to find any common measure for all these statements? Would it not be better to unite with those who cut the Gordian knot by writing down all religion simply as illusion? No. For their point of view is meaningless. Even illusions are, in themselves, facts to be investigated; and even illusions have a basis.

But it is not necessary to believe that it is an illusion; the knot may be untied. Ritual, Creed, Morality, Mystical Experience--all these are manifestations of religion, but not religion itself. Religion itself is the reaction between man as a personality on the one side, and, on the other, all of the universe with which he comes in contact. It is not only ritual, for you may have obviously non-religious ritual, as in a court ceremonial or a legal function: it is not merely morality, for men may practise morality, the most austere or the most _terre à terre_, uninspired by anything that could remotely be called religious: it is not belief, for we may have beliefs of all kinds, even to the most complex scientific beliefs concerning the universe, which have yet no connection with religion: it is neither communion in itself, nor ecstasy in itself, as many lovers and poets could tell you.

But because it is a reaction of the whole personality, it must involve intellectual _and_ practical _and_ emotional processes: and because man has the powers of abstraction and association, or rather because his mind in most cases cannot help making associations and abstractions, it follows that it will inevitably concern itself, consciously or subconsciously, with all the phenomena that it encounters, will try to bring them all into its scheme, and will try to unify them and frame concepts to deal with them as a whole.

Some men will be more concerned on the emotional, others on the intellectual, others again on the moral side: but it is impossible to separate any one of the three aspects entirely from the others.

We will begin with and treat mainly of the intellectual aspect of the problem, the credal side. For one thing, science has more direct concern with it than with the others; for another, more continuous and startling alterations have had to be made in it; and finally, the actual problem is there felt most acutely at the present moment.

What, then, is the problem? In the terms of our definition of religion, it is in its most general terms as follows: Man has to live his life in a world in which he is confronted with forces and powers other than his own. He is a mere animalcule in comparison with the totality of these forces, his life a second in comparison with their centuries. By his mental constitution, he of necessity attempts to formulate some intelligible account of the constitution of the world and its relation to himself--or should we rather say in so far as it is in relation to himself?--and so we have a myth, a doctrine, or a creed.

At the present moment, as we have already seen, there appears to be an irreconcilable conflict between orthodox Christianity and orthodox Natural Science. The one asserts the existence of an omnipotent, omniscient, personal God--creator, ruler, and refuge. The other, by reducing ever more and more of natural phenomena to what we please to call natural laws--in other words, to orderly processes proceeding inevitably from the known constitution and properties of matter--has robbed such a God of ever more and more of his realm and possible power; until finally, with the rise of evolutionary biology and psychology, there seems to be no place any more for a God in the universe.

Stated thus, the opposition is complete. But let us return on our footsteps, and trace for one thing some of the history of religious beliefs, for another re-investigate, from a slightly unusual standpoint, the actual knowledge of the Universe which science has given us.

Man has developed: in early stages, his physical and mental capacities developed; in later stages development has been mainly restricted to his traditions, ideas, and achievements. As part of his development, his religious ideas have altered too.

At the beginning, he appears to have no ideas of a God of Gods at all--merely of influences and powers, obviously (he would say) inherent in the forces of Nature, magically inherent in certain objects and actions--fetishes and incantations. He seems scarcely to have been conscious of himself as an individual, or of the full distinction between self and the external world.

Later, perhaps as the idea of his own personality grew, he began to ascribe a more personal existence to the forces with which he came into contact, and so to turn them more and more into beings that can properly be called Gods: polydaemonism arose and in its turn gave place to polytheism.

But while rigid custom was at first the only morality, and each external power and each human activity was regarded separately, later the rise of civilization led to a modification of custom, to a reference of action and belief to the standards of pure reason, and to an attempt at unification. Once this occurred, and equally so whether the attempt at unification had an intellectual or a moral basis, polytheism was doomed. Its downfall has been often described; the reasons for it are suggestively put by Jevons in his little book, “The Idea of God.” It passes through a stage where one among the gods is pre-eminent: but finally even that does not suffice, and in its place arises a monotheistic creed.

Monotheism may start as a purely local or tribal affair--my one God against yours. It may not only start, but long continue so. Readers of Mr. Bang’s collection of startling German war-sayings will remember the superbly national prayer of the Prussian pastor who addressed his God (I quote from memory) as “Du, der hoch über Cherubinen, Seraphinen, und Zeppelinen ewig trönst.” (J. P. Bang, _Hurrah and Hallelujah_. London, 1916.) But this idea, too, is self-contradictory, and merges into that of one God for all men. The primitive anthropomorphism which had invested the first vague and mysterious spirits with human parts and passions, human speech and thought, also fell into gradual desuetude. It was kept up as a symbol, or because of the difficulty of describing a God except in terms human individuality, but its literal truth was deliberately denied. God became different from and more than man--omnipotent, omniscient, with no parts, with no limitations: but he retained personality--in other words, a mental or spiritual organization of the same general kind as man’s, however superior in degree. With time, the divine personality became compounded more and more of man’s ideals instead of his everyday thoughts and attributes. And thus and that God remains. He has created everything; he is in some sense immanent in the world, in some sense apart from it as its ruler--you take your choice according to your philosophic preferences. Beyond that, organized religious thought has not gone; and now it finds itself fronting science in an impasse.

That, very briefly and roughly, is how man’s idea of God has developed. But how have man’s knowledge and ideas of the natural universe developed? What has Science to say to the impasse?

Man has to deal with three great categories of phenomena--the inorganic, the organic, and the psychic. In the inorganic, chemistry first and then physics have given us a picture whose broad outlines are now familiar. There is but one type and store of energy in Nature, whether it drives a train, animates a man, radiates in heat or light, inheres in a falling stone. There is but one substance. All bodies of trees, of men, rivers and rocks, the clouds in the air and the air itself, precious stones and common clay--all can be resolved into a limited number of elements. And these elements in their turn can be resolved into combinations, differing, it appears, only quantitatively from each other, of electrical charges; so that at the last all matter is one, and becomes perhaps indistinguishable, or at least inseparable, from energy. There is no personal operator for particular happenings; the lightning and the volcano are the inevitable outcome of the material constitution of things, equally with the form and colour of a pebble and with the fact that it will drop to the ground if it is let fall. All is impersonal order and unity.

There is, however, one other great fact about the system of inorganic matter. The energy contained in it tends to be degraded, as the physicists say--in other words to become less readily available. There is available energy in moving matter. There is potential energy in all matter, dependent upon whether it can be set in motion. But if the sea were to cover the whole surface of the globe, it would be impossible to extract energy from running water as we do now, because no water would be running. So too heat is energy; but it is only available when it can flow, when there are hotter and colder bodies. The law under which transformations of energy operate has now been investigated, and it has been established that in every energy-transaction a certain modicum goes to waste as unavailable heat, so that, unless some at present unforeseen change occurs, the last state of the universe, considered as a purely physico-chemical mechanism, will be one of death, of inactivity, with all matter at a uniform low temperature and the whole stock of energy locked up and unavailable in this sea of tranquillity. True for one thing that an almost inconceivable number of millions of years must elapse before this “death of matter” is realized; and for another that we are unable to understand how such a progressive degradation could have been in operation from all eternity. We must not expect complete knowledge within a few years or a few centuries; but even if the beginning is veiled--for there is no more evidence for a “creation” than for (say) a rhythmic reversal of the direction of energy-availability--and if it is always possible that some unforeseen change in the process should occur before the whole runs down, yet it is a fact (and we are resolved to be agnostic save about facts) that, here and now, a direction is to be observed in the evolution of inorganic matter, by which natural operations are tending to become less active, and the amount of available energy is diminishing. If it continues indefinitely, first life, and later on all activity and change whatsoever will cease. There is a tendency towards death and towards unchanging inactivity.

The next great category is that of the organic, of living matter. We have to consider its origin and later history. So far as constitution goes, living matter is merely a special and highly complicated form of ordinary matter; and there can be no reasonable doubt that it has originated naturally from non-living matter.
